The canonical URL to the results on the autobuilder server wants the sha1 to be prefixed with the first three letters of the sha1, like so: b52/b52c54eafc2ea8814bb49850823e55d8e034d33d Currently, this is done by a redirect on the server, but it is broken, so that requests that do not conform to that scheme return empty results. See for example the difference between those two calls: wget -O OK 'http://autobuild.buildroot.org/results/b2c/b2cefd7d362c12ed99b708d11b988704778d450c/defconfig' wget -O KO 'http://autobuild.buildroot.org/results/b2cefd7d362c12ed99b708d11b988704778d450c/defconfig' So, currently, passing only the sah1 on the command line of br-reproduce would not work, because the sha1 is used as-is to construct the URL. To make it work, a user had to pass the sha1 prefixed with the first three chars. However, this is not very convenient. Fix that: - internally reconstruct the canonical URL; - still accept a prefix-sha1 on the command line (for users that got used to that behaviour).
